The Texas-based grocer confirmed to Chron that it would open a store in Lubbock at the southwest corner of 19th Street and Frankford Avenue, marking the second location for the city.
A filing with the Texas Department of Licensing and Regulation shows an estimated cost of $237 million and a project completion date of Nov. 10, 2027. According to KCBD, the development will include a 130,000-square-foot store, a car wash and a gas station…
